## Authentication

Heads up: the nightly reindex job (`reindex_nightly.py`) talks to the Lanternfish search cluster, and that cluster won't accept anonymous writes anymore — we locked it down last sprint. The job now authenticates as the `reindex-runner` service identity against Corvid Gateway, and the token is injected via the `LF_INDEX_TOKEN` env var in the scheduler config. Nothing clever going on, just a bearer header on every batch request. For review purposes, the staging credential currently in use is listed below.

service key, kadug-kadup: kto15_rN23XLAYImmZgrJ

## Releases

Hey support folks — quick notes on ProfileMesh shard releases. Each release re-balances user-profile shards gradually, so don't panic if a lookup lands on a stale shard for a few minutes post-deploy; it self-heals. Release bundles are published twice a month and are always signed. If a customer asks you to verify a bundle they downloaded, walk them through the checksum step using the public signing key below.

deploy key for kawif-bageg: bky19_YQNdHDgpaLxUNwPoHm9

## Formula sandbox tuning

User-supplied formulas in Gridmoor execute inside a restricted interpreter with hard ceilings on time, memory, and call depth. Reviewers should confirm any change to these ceilings is justified in the PR description, since raising them widens the abuse surface. Defaults were chosen from production traces. The current limits are as follows.

limits module of tafog-fawip:
WEIGHTS = {
    "julix": 57,
    "lamys": 992,
    "kasvan": 209,
    "quenok": 750,
    "alddor": 259,
    "oliath": 1009,
    "wenix": 815,
}